本文目录导读:
随着互联网技术的飞速发展,企业对服务器性能的要求越来越高,为了提高网站和应用系统的可用性、稳定性和安全性,负载均衡服务器应运而生,本文将深入探讨负载均衡服务器的配置方法,帮助您高效运维。
负载均衡服务器概述
负载均衡服务器是一种将网络流量分发到多个服务器上的技术,以实现以下目的:
1、提高网站和应用系统的可用性;
图片来源于网络,如有侵权联系删除
2、增强系统性能,提高用户访问速度;
3、防止单点故障,提高系统稳定性;
4、优化资源利用率,降低运维成本。
负载均衡服务器配置方法
1、选择合适的负载均衡算法
负载均衡算法是负载均衡服务器的核心,常见的算法有轮询、最少连接、IP哈希等,以下为几种常用算法的特点:
(1)轮询:按照服务器顺序依次分配请求,简单易实现,但可能导致请求不均匀。
(2)最少连接:优先将请求分配到连接数最少的服务器,避免请求堆积。
(3)IP哈希:根据用户IP地址进行哈希,将请求分配到同一服务器,实现会话保持。
2、配置服务器
图片来源于网络,如有侵权联系删除
(1)硬件配置:选择高性能的服务器硬件,如CPU、内存、硬盘等。
(2)软件配置:安装操作系统、数据库、应用服务器等,确保软件兼容性。
(3)网络配置:配置网络接口、IP地址、子网掩码等,确保服务器之间通信正常。
3、安装负载均衡软件
根据需求选择合适的负载均衡软件,如Nginx、LVS、HAProxy等,以下以Nginx为例,介绍安装步骤:
(1)下载Nginx安装包:http://nginx.org/en/download.html
(2)解压安装包:tar -zxvf nginx-1.17.1.tar.gz
(3)进入安装目录:cd nginx-1.17.1
(4)编译安装:./configure && make && make install
图片来源于网络,如有侵权联系删除
4、配置负载均衡规则
(1)编辑Nginx配置文件:vi /etc/nginx/nginx.conf
(2)添加upstream模块:upstream myapp { server 192.168.1.100; server 192.168.1.101; server 192.168.1.102; }
(3)配置server模块:server { listen 80; server_name www.myapp.com; location / { proxy_pass http://myapp; } }
5、验证配置
(1)启动Nginx:systemctl start nginx
(2)测试负载均衡效果:使用工具(如ping、curl等)访问服务器,观察请求是否均匀分配到各个服务器。
负载均衡服务器配置是提高网站和应用系统性能的关键环节,通过选择合适的算法、配置服务器、安装软件和设置规则,可以实现高效、稳定的运维,在实际应用中,还需不断优化和调整,以满足企业不断变化的需求。
标签: #负载均衡服务器
评论列表